Modesto homeless found living in elaborate riverside caves
ABC10 ^ | January 24, 2024 | Gabriel Porras

Posted on 01/25/2024 1:54:34 PM PST by packagingguy

Caves equipped with tables, chairs and even beds — that's what officials in Modesto say the homeless along the Tuolumne River were living in, up until a clean-up last weekend.

Police tape and barricades went up Wednesday along the river near Crater Avenue and Dallas Street in Modesto, meant to keep the homeless out.

“They’re building some interesting caves," said Brian Brandenburg, who lives in the neighborhood and walks his dog along the river every day.

Brandenburg always knew the homeless sought shelter in the area but didn’t know to what extent, until volunteers and officers with Modesto Police’s Community Health and Assistance Team cleaned up the area on Saturday.

“Honestly, I just started laughing and said how creative they were," said Brandenburg of the caves.

The weekend clean-up exposed eight caves dug into the river bed, as wide as 10 feet, according to volunteers. While some neighbors had safety concerns learning about the caves inches away from the waters of the Tuolumne River, others asked where else the homeless would go.

“I know it’s dangerous, but they’re also out in the elements," said Brandenburg. "What’s (more) dangerous? Freezing or starving, or living in a cave that I’m sure they know how they built and they know how sturdy it’s going to be?"...

In a Facebook post, Modesto police said that officials offered resources to transition the homeless from the caves into shelter or housing over the weekend.

However, for some neighbors like Brandenburg, the caves aren't a problem.

"Let them have their peace, they’re out of everybody’s way," said Brandenburg. “I mean, it’s getting them out of the weather, it’s not hindering anybody and I thought it was a good idea they did it.”
